Amass Docs¶
OWASP Amass is an open-source, versatile attack surface intelligence framework designed to comprehensively map an organization’s footprint. Built for flexibility and depth, Amass combines advanced data collection, network mapping, and OSINT capabilities to deliver detailed insights into physical and digital assets.
// Overview¶
OWASP Amass extends far beyond basic subdomain enumeration, offering a comprehensive, automated approach to information gathering that reveals the full scope of an entity's physical and digital footprint.
Open Asset Model (OAM)
The Open Asset Model expands traditional specifications by modeling both the physical and digital structure of a target's asset landscape. Defining asset types, their unique properties, and the relationships that join them, the OAM
compiles a comprehensive view of the attack surface from an adversarial perspective.

Automated Deployment and Enumeration: Easily deploy Amass with Docker Compose for quick, automated asset discovery across multiple domains with minimal configuration.
-
Centralized Asset Management with Asset DB: Use the Asset DB for storing, managing, and retrieving discovered assets, with support for long-term tracking and consistent data collection via the Open Asset Model.
-
Scalable and Flexible Infrastructure: Designed for enterprise environments, Docker enables scalable deployments of Amass, ensuring consistent attack surface management for organizations of any size.
-
Advanced Collection and Monitoring: The Collections Engine refines the data collection process, while open-source tools like syslog-ng provide centralized logging, enabling real-time monitoring and diagnostics.
-
Visualization and Data-Driven Insights: The latest release features a fully integrated Grafana dashboard, providing dynamic visualization and analysis for deeper attack surface intelligence.

Step 1: Clone the Amass Docker Compose Directory¶
Start by cloning the OWASP Amass repository containing the Docker Compose setup files.
git clone https://github.com/owasp-amass/amass-docker-compose.git
mv amass-docker-compose amass # Optional: Rename the directory to something shorter (e.g., amass)
cd amass # Navigate to the local repository
